Address

Address Rc4zu586jpcR5d7CY8JtfPfrx5U8vwkoqC
Created
Last active
Received 817.62437885 RPD
Sent 817.62437885 RPD
Balance 0 RPD
Copyright © 2021 Rapids Explorer